package org.openlmis.equipment.service;
import org.junit.Test;
import org.junit.experimental.categories.Category;
import org.junit.runner.RunWith;
import org.mockito.InjectMocks;
import org.mockito.Mock;
import org.mockito.runners.MockitoJUnitRunner;
import org.openlmis.core.domain.Pagination;
import org.openlmis.db.categories.UnitTests;
import org.openlmis.equipment.domain.ColdChainEquipment;
import org.openlmis.equipment.domain.Equipment;
import org.openlmis.equipment.repository.ColdChainEquipmentRepository;
import org.openlmis.equipment.repository.EquipmentRepository;
import java.util.ArrayList;
import java.util.List;
import static junit.framework.Assert.assertEquals;
import static org.mockito.Mockito.never;
import static org.mockito.Mockito.verify;
import static org.powermock.api.mockito.PowerMockito.when;
@Category(UnitTests.class)
@RunWith(MockitoJUnitRunner.class)
public class EquipmentServiceTest {
@Mock
private EquipmentRepository repository;
@Mock
private ColdChainEquipmentRepository coldChainEquipmentRepository;
@InjectMocks
private EquipmentService service;
@Test
public void shouldGetAll() throws Exception {
List<Equipment> expectedEquipments = new ArrayList<Equipment>();
expectedEquipments.add(new Equipment());
when(repository.getAll()).thenReturn(expectedEquipments);
List<Equipment> equipments = service.getAll();
verify(repository).getAll();
assertEquals(equipments, expectedEquipments);
}
@Test
public void shouldGetAllCCE() throws Exception {
Pagination page=new Pagination();
List<ColdChainEquipment> expectedEquipments = new ArrayList<ColdChainEquipment>();
expectedEquipments.add(new ColdChainEquipment());
when(coldChainEquipmentRepository.getAll(1L,page)).thenReturn(expectedEquipments);
List<ColdChainEquipment> equipments = service.getAllCCE(1L, page);
verify(coldChainEquipmentRepository).getAll(1L, page);
assertEquals(equipments, expectedEquipments);
}
@Test
public void shouldGetById() throws Exception {
Equipment equipment = new Equipment();
equipment.setName("123");
when(repository.getById(1L)).thenReturn(equipment);
Equipment result = service.getById(1L);
assertEquals(result.getName(), equipment.getName());
}
@Test
public void shouldGetTypesByProgram() throws Exception {
Equipment equipment = new Equipment();
equipment.setName("123");
when(repository.getById(1L)).thenReturn(equipment);
Equipment result = service.getById(1L);
assertEquals(result.getName(), equipment.getName());
}
@Test
public void shouldSaveNewEquipment() throws Exception {
Equipment equipment = new Equipment();
equipment.setName("123");
service.saveEquipment(equipment);
verify(repository).insert(equipment);
verify(repository, never()).update(equipment);
}
@Test
public void shouldSaveChangesInExistingEquipment() throws Exception {
Equipment equipment = new Equipment();
equipment.setId(1L);
equipment.setName("123");
service.updateEquipment(equipment);
verify(repository, never()).insert(equipment);
verify(repository).update(equipment);
}
}
